English Bay beach

English Bay is a beach located in a secluded bay near the West End of British Columbia, in the heart of Vancouver. The resort is known for its picturesque sunset views, clean beach, transparent water and gentle sun.

Beach description

The ocean is clear, warm in summer. English Bay is artificial, white sand was brought on the territory in 1898, today the beach is very popular and crowded.

Tourists have fun on pleasure boats, play volleyball, frisbee, ride bicycles, rollers, longboards. Plenty of room to sunbathe, do sports, jogging or a full training session. On the horizon, you can notice big ships, the tankers. There are locker rooms, beach houses, many shops, restaurants, cafes, parking lots. The pathways are paved with dwarf palm trees growing along them.

Many people come to the beach to sunbathe and have a picnic. People of all ages with different interests spend their holidays here – a great beach to make a new acquaintance. In the summer, numerous festivals take place on the territory of English Bay:

  • Pride Parade,
  • two-week fireworks festival,
  • Polar Bear is a New Year's swim dedicated to polar bears and many others.
